Ticket: Partition config drift — ledger_events table

Prod partitions ledger_events by month via the Cartwheel scheduler. Staging was found creating weekly partitions instead — manual change from March, never reverted. Result: retention jobs mismatch and queries in staging don't reproduce prod plans. Fix: align staging to monthly, drop the stray weekly partitions after backfill. Maintainers: do not hand-edit partition settings; all changes go through the pipeline. Prod's authoritative partitioning settings are listed below.

deployment values, yafop-tahof:
HOLIX_HOST=holix.zemvarsys.internal
HOLIX_PORT=3306

Subject: DR drill — template rendering

Mara,

Drill is Thursday 0900. We'll fail Quartzline's template renderer over to the Dunholt replica and measure cold-render latency. Target: under 400ms p95. Release freeze holds until results post. The replica vault is sealed per policy; to unseal it at drill start, enter the passphrase below.

recovery phrase for fahap-haduf: casvan-eliius-novmir-holiel-oliwyn-brivan-gilax-gilael-gilax-wenius-rusael-istius-ralys-julwyn

## Quotaduck changelog — per-tenant rate quotas

Heads up, on-call folks: we renamed `TENANT_RPS_CAP` to `QUOTADUCK_TENANT_QUOTA` because the old name lied — it's quota units, not raw RPS. The alias still works for two releases, then it's gone. If you're rotating configs tonight, update the name in every env file you touch, and remember the quota service's admin secret goes on the line right after the renamed setting. Append that line next.

sealed setting: ARCHIVE_KEY3=8d0